What companies run services between Marseille, France and Castelo Branco, Portugal?

FlixBus operates a bus from Marseille to Castelo Branco 3 times a week. Tickets cost €130–220 and the journey takes 23h 15m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Marseille St Charles to Castelo Branco via Madrid-Puerta de Atocha-Almudena Grandes, Badajoz, and Abrantes in around 18h 55m.
